Finding the perfect setup for office tea brewing is a common challenge for tea lovers. With limited desk space, no access to plumbing for drainage, and the drying effects of office air conditioning, the ideal solution is to adopt the “dry brewing” method. By using compact tea trays designed for minimal footprint, you can keep your desk tidy while creating a sophisticated daily tea ritual.
Why “Dry Brewing” is Perfect for the Office
The dry brewing method (ganpao) focuses on simplicity and keeping the workspace clean. Traditional “wet brewing,” which involves rinsing teaware and dumping excess water directly onto the tray, can be messy and impractical in a corporate setting. By treating the tea tray as a clean stage for your teaware and using a dedicated waste-water bowl (jianshui) for rinsing, you maintain a professional, organized, and serene workspace, even during a high-pressure workday.
Choosing the Right Tea Tray: A Comparison of Four Materials
When selecting an office tea tray, prioritize durability, ease of maintenance, and the ability to withstand a climate-controlled environment.
Bakelite Tea Trays: The Pragmatic Choice
Often requested by office tea enthusiasts, Bakelite (phenolic resin) is highly recommended. Despite its name, it is a synthetic, heat-resistant, and non-porous material. CNC-machined Bakelite trays often feature a matte finish that resembles high-end ebony. Bakelite tea trays are virtually immune to cracking in dry, air-conditioned rooms, making them the ultimate low-maintenance partner for busy professionals.
Wujin Stone (Black Gold Stone): Minimalist & Sleek
For a modern, minimalist aesthetic, Wujin stone is an excellent choice. This dense, natural stone is cold to the touch and adds a sophisticated contrast to ceramic or glass teaware. It is extremely durable, heat-resistant, and requires very little maintenance. Because stone can be hard on delicate teaware, we recommend using a soft tea cloth under your teacup to protect both your equipment and your desk surface.
Solid Wood: Warmth with Care
Solid wood trays, such as rosewood or ebony, provide an unmatched natural beauty that develops a unique patina over time. However, they are sensitive to the low humidity of office environments. If you prefer the warmth of wood, opt for a smaller, compact tray and be sure to wipe it down with a damp cloth at the end of the day to prevent cracking.
Bamboo: Lightweight & Budget-Friendly
Bamboo is a classic entry-level option. These trays are lightweight and often feature a dual-layer design with a removable grate. While they are affordable and visually refreshing, they are prone to moisture-related issues. To keep your bamboo tray in top shape, ensure it is cleaned and allowed to dry completely after every use to prevent mold or warping.

Creating Your Minimalist Office Tea Station
The key to a successful office tea ritual is miniaturization. Keep your setup efficient:
- Brewing Vessel (110ml–150ml): A small Gaiwan is perfect for the office; it is versatile, easy to clean, and helps control extraction time.
- Glass Fairness Pitcher: A transparent pitcher allows you to appreciate the color of your tea against office lighting.
- Waste-Water Bowl (Jianshui): A deep ceramic bowl or a stylish, wide-mouth mug can function as an elegant waste-water vessel, keeping your desk dry throughout the day.
FAQ: Office Tea Brewing
Do Bakelite trays release a plastic odor when in contact with hot water?
High-quality Bakelite should not emit an odor. Any initial factory scent usually dissipates after the first few rinses with hot water. If a strong, persistent chemical smell remains, it may be an inferior imitation product.
How do I prevent wooden trays from cracking in dry offices?
Maintain the wood by wiping the surface with a damp cloth daily. During long weekends, you can place a damp towel over the tray to help it retain moisture.
